Stephen Chow’s ROYAL TRAMP (1992) and ROYAL TRAMP 2 (1992) arrive on region 1 DVD this week courtesy of The Weinstein Company’s Dragon Dynasty label in The ROYAL TRAMP Collection 2-Disc Special Edition.

The Royal Tramp Collection

The films bring together the nonsensical comedy genius of Stephen Chow (KUNG FU HUSTLE) with insanely dynamic wirework action from Ching Siu-tung (HOUSE OF FLYING DAGGERS) and the irreverent writing and direction of Wong Jing (CITY HUNTER).

Adapted from Louis Cha’s final wuxia novel, the films depict the efforts of a crafty son of a prostitute with no kung fu skills to infiltrate the court of the Qing Dynasty for a rebellious secret society and best some of the martial world’s most notorious fighters with little more than his wits and a lot of luck.

Dragon Dynasty’s two-disc DVD release features audio commentary for both films from Hong Kong cinema expert Bey Logan, original theatrical trailers and an interview with Wong Jing.

Tech specs include English and original Cantonese audio tracks in Dolby Digital 5.1, optional English or Spanish subtitles, and a value-friendly suggested retail price of $19.95.
